Beyond Detection: The Benefits of a Mod Compatibility Tester

Beyond simply detecting conflicts, a mod compatibility tester often provides invaluable information and assistance in resolving the issues it identifies. Many of these tools recommend specific load orders, which is the sequence in which the mods are loaded by the game. The load order can have a critical impact on compatibility; incorrect order is often the cause of a game crashing. By suggesting an optimized load order, the mod compatibility tester can help ensure that mods function correctly, preventing many common problems. LOOT (Load Order Optimisation Tool)

For games like *Skyrim* and *Fallout 4*, tools like LOOT (Load Order Optimisation Tool) are essential. LOOT is an open-source load order optimization tool designed to automatically sort your mod list. It’s a powerhouse, supporting many games. It analyzes your mods, detects conflicts, and provides recommendations for load order.

Nexus Mod Manager/Vortex

Another popular option is the Nexus Mod Manager (NMM) or its modern successor, Vortex, available on the Nexus Mods website. While not dedicated solely to testing compatibility, these mod managers offer built-in conflict detection and load order management features. They also support various games, making them great all-around tools.

Mod Organizer 2 (MO2)

Then there’s Mod Organizer 2 (MO2), a powerful, feature-rich tool that gives users unparalleled control over their modding experience. MO2 uses virtual file systems, which means the original game files are not modified, greatly simplifying the process. It’s an excellent choice for more experienced modders.

Troubleshooting Mod Conflicts: Practical Tips

Troubleshooting mod conflicts can sometimes be a detective game, but these steps can help:

  • Carefully analyze any error messages that are generated by either the game or the mod compatibility tester. These messages often provide clues as to which mods are causing the problem.
  • Consult the mod’s documentation for compatibility notes. Many mod authors will include specific instructions regarding load order or conflicts with other mods.
  • Test mods in small groups to isolate the problem. Install a few mods at a time, test them, and then install a few more. This method helps identify which mods are causing conflicts.
  • Prioritize load order based on mod instructions and the recommendations of your mod compatibility tester. The correct order is crucial for resolving many conflicts.
  • If all else fails, reinstall mods, or revert to earlier versions of a mod. Sometimes a mod is simply broken, and needs a fresh download.
